当前位置: 首页 > news >正文

自己做的网站怎么用qq登入谷歌chrome安卓版

自己做的网站怎么用qq登入,谷歌chrome安卓版,网站改版不更换域名 .net怎么做301网站重定向,专业做足球体彩网站目录 1. 说明2. 堆上分配3. 栈上分配(逃逸分析和标量替换)4. 方法区分配5. 直接内存(非堆内存) 1. 说明 1.JVM的对象并不总是分配在堆上。2.堆是JVM用于存储对象实例的主要内存区域,存在一些特殊情况,对象…

目录

          • 1. 说明
          • 2. 堆上分配
          • 3. 栈上分配(逃逸分析和标量替换)
          • 4. 方法区分配
          • 5. 直接内存(非堆内存)

1. 说明
  • 1.JVM的对象并不总是分配在堆上。
  • 2.堆是JVM用于存储对象实例的主要内存区域,存在一些特殊情况,对象可能会被分配在其他地方。
2. 堆上分配
  • 1.堆(Heap)是JVM内存管理的核心区域,用于存储几乎所有的对象实例和数组。
  • 2.当创建一个新的对象时,JVM通常会在堆上为其分配内存。
  • 3.堆内存的管理由垃圾回收器(GC)负责,GC会定期扫描堆内存,回收不再使用的对象所占用的内存空间。
3. 栈上分配(逃逸分析和标量替换)
  • 1.逃逸分析是JVM的一种优化技术,用于判断一个对象是否可能逃逸出当前作用域。
  • 2.如果一个对象在方法执行过程中始终只在当前作用域内使用,不会逃逸到方法外部,那么JVM可能会将这个对象分配到栈上,而不是堆上。
  • 3.标量替换是逃逸分析的一种结果。如果一个对象可以被拆解为多个标量(如基本数据类型),并且这些标量可以在栈上独立使用,那么JVM会将这些标量直接分配到栈上,而不是创建一个对象。
4. 方法区分配
  • 1.方法区(Method Area)或称为永久代(PermGen space,在JDK 8之前)或元空间(Metaspace,在JDK 8及之后)是JVM用于存储类的结构信息的内存区域。
  • 2.类加载器将类的元数据(如类名、字段、方法、常量池等)加载到方法区中。
  • 3.方法区不是用于存储对象实例的,但一些与类相关的特殊对象(如类的静态变量、常量池中的字符串和符号引用等)会存储在方法区中。
5. 直接内存(非堆内存)
  • 1.直接内存(Direct Memory)或称为本地内存(Native Memory)不是由JVM直接管理的,而是由操作系统管理的。
  • 2.在Java中,可以使用sun.misc.Unsafe类或java.nio.ByteBuffer类来分配直接内存。
  • 3.直接内存通常用于高性能IO操作,如网络IO和文件IO,因为它可以避免将数据从JVM堆内存复制到操作系统的内存缓冲区中。
http://www.mmbaike.com/news/28946.html

相关文章:

  • 网站域名在哪里注册b2b平台是什么意思
  • aspit网站源码带手机版今日新闻最新消息
  • 金融企业网站源码企业网站有什么
  • 百度加速乐wordpress网站建设优化收费
  • wordpress单页淘宝客东莞百度快速排名优化
  • 上海网站建设制作微信网站建站教程
  • 做企业的网站都要准备什么手续推广软文代发
  • 找工作上什么网哈尔滨优化调整人员流动管理
  • 郑州网站建设公司前景枸橼酸西地那非片功效效及作用
  • 专业的英文网站建设如何建立免费个人网站
  • 国外优秀摄影网站个人免费自助建站网站
  • 做网站推广挣多少钱网站seo查询站长之家
  • 深圳红酒网站建设网络营销渠道策略
  • 网站怎么做关键词在哪做市场营销的策划方案
  • 镇江网站建设dmooo网络营销论文
  • 网站图片一般多大尺寸活动策划公司
  • wordpress 下载页面谷歌外贸seo
  • 网页制作属于前端吗win7优化
  • 个人开发网站雷神代刷网站推广
  • 火车头采集器wordpress成都seo推广员
  • 中国人做网站卖美国人客服外包平台
  • 网站验证钱的分录怎么做高端网站建设定制
  • 易站通这个网站怎么做有免费做网站的吗
  • 深圳网站建设 网站设计seo门户网
  • j2ee做网站微博上如何做网站推广
  • 广州疫情被中央点名seo如何优化网站
  • 大型的网站开发宣传推广渠道有哪些
  • 网站域名备案在哪里排名优化公司口碑哪家好
  • 北京建机官网宜昌网站seo
  • 国外 优秀网站设计做推广的软件有哪些